I have to agree with Jon Weisberger on this one.  We have to give artists the freedom to experiment and express themselves or this music is headed nowhere, fast. 

As a side note, I have heard Flatt & Scruggs on vintage Opry broadcasts performing “Cryin Holy Unto the Lord”, and the drums were as loud as any country song.  Jimmy Martin played it “good’n country” with drums too, and it worked great for me.

 IBMA is not here to decide what is bluegrass and what is not.  That’s our job!
